ubuntu更新后软件中心无法打开的解决办法

昨天在ubuntu的中安装了一下“Python版webqq客户端”程序,结果今天更新了系统重启后,发现ubuntu软件中心打不开了,在网上找到了如下解决办法。

初步判断是因为安装那个webqq客户端的时候,添加了linuxdeepin(深度)的软件源导致的。

gongstring@chz-desktop:~$ software-center

Traceback (most recent call last):

File "/usr/bin/software-center", line 149, in

from softwarecenter.ui.gtk3.app import SoftwareCenterAppGtk3

File "/usr/share/software-center/softwarecenter/ui/gtk3/app.py", line 49, in

from softwarecenter.db.application import Application

File "/usr/share/software-center/softwarecenter/db/application.py", line 25, in

from softwarecenter.backend.channel import is_channel_available

File "/usr/share/software-center/softwarecenter/backend/channel.py", line 25, in

from softwarecenter.distro import get_distro

File "/usr/share/software-center/softwarecenter/distro/__init__.py", line 165, in

distro_instance=_get_distro()

File "/usr/share/software-center/softwarecenter/distro/__init__.py", line 148, in _get_distro

module = __import__(distro_id, globals(), locals(), [], -1)

ImportError: No module named LinuxDeepin

解决办法如下:

sudo gedit /etc/lsb-release (好吧,我不会VIM -.-!)

用以下内容替换其中的文本:

DISTRIB_ID=Ubuntu

DISTRIB_RELEASE=11.10

DISTRIB_CODENAME=oneiric

DISTRIB_DESCRIPTION=“Ubuntu 11.10″

OK,此时应该就可以打开软件源、软件中心了。

不过还是碰到了个问题,软件中心是打开了,页面却一直处于空白的刷新界面。

卸载重装:

sudo apt-get autoremove software-center --purge

显示:

rmdir: 删除 “/var/cache/software-center/xapian/” 失败: 没有那个文件或目录

dpkg:处理 software-center (--purge)时出错:

子进程 已安装 post-removal 脚本 返回了错误号 1

在处理时有错误发生:

software-center

E: Sub-process /usr/bin/dpkg returned an error code (1)

查找了一下,cache文件夹下没有software-center文件。

sudo mkdir /var/cache/software-center

sudo mkdir /var/cache/software-center/xapian

sudo apt-get autoremove software-center --purge

sudo apt-get install software-center

一切正常。

昨天在ubuntu的中安装了一下“Python版webqq客户端”程序,结果今天更新了系统重启后,发现ubuntu软件中心打不开了,在网上找到了如下解决办法。

初步判断是因为安装那个webqq客户端的时候,添加了linuxdeepin(深度)的软件源导致的。

gongstring@chz-desktop:~$ software-center

Traceback (most recent call last):

File "/usr/bin/software-center", line 149, in

from softwarecenter.ui.gtk3.app import SoftwareCenterAppGtk3

File "/usr/share/software-center/softwarecenter/ui/gtk3/app.py", line 49, in

from softwarecenter.db.application import Application

File "/usr/share/software-center/softwarecenter/db/application.py", line 25, in

from softwarecenter.backend.channel import is_channel_available

File "/usr/share/software-center/softwarecenter/backend/channel.py", line 25, in

from softwarecenter.distro import get_distro

File "/usr/share/software-center/softwarecenter/distro/__init__.py", line 165, in

distro_instance=_get_distro()

File "/usr/share/software-center/softwarecenter/distro/__init__.py", line 148, in _get_distro

module = __import__(distro_id, globals(), locals(), [], -1)

ImportError: No module named LinuxDeepin

解决办法如下:

sudo gedit /etc/lsb-release (好吧,我不会VIM -.-!)

用以下内容替换其中的文本:

DISTRIB_ID=Ubuntu

DISTRIB_RELEASE=11.10

DISTRIB_CODENAME=oneiric

DISTRIB_DESCRIPTION=“Ubuntu 11.10″

OK,此时应该就可以打开软件源、软件中心了。

不过还是碰到了个问题,软件中心是打开了,页面却一直处于空白的刷新界面。

卸载重装:

sudo apt-get autoremove software-center --purge

显示:

rmdir: 删除 “/var/cache/software-center/xapian/” 失败: 没有那个文件或目录

dpkg:处理 software-center (--purge)时出错:

子进程 已安装 post-removal 脚本 返回了错误号 1

在处理时有错误发生:

software-center

E: Sub-process /usr/bin/dpkg returned an error code (1)

查找了一下,cache文件夹下没有software-center文件。

sudo mkdir /var/cache/software-center

sudo mkdir /var/cache/software-center/xapian

sudo apt-get autoremove software-center --purge

sudo apt-get install software-center

一切正常。


相关内容

  • 在Ubuntu系统上使用Samba4来创建活动目录架构(一)
  • Samba 是一个自由的开源软件套件,用于实现 Windows 操作系统与 Linux/Unix 系统之间的无缝连接及共享资源. Samba 不仅可以通过 SMB/CIFS 协议组件来为 Windows 与 Linux 系统之间提供独立的文件及打印机共享服务,它还能实现活动目录(Active Dir ...

  • 第四届知识竞赛试题
  • 浙江大学宁波理工学院计算机协会 第四届"计算机知识竞赛"试题 命题人:计算机协会维修技术部 审核:张日东 许相元 杜浩 高恒修 2011年11月12日 一.单项选择题(每小题仅一个正确答案,1-25题每题1分,26-35题每题2分,共35分) 1. 谷歌公司在2011年8月15日 ...

  • 基于开源软件的私有云计算平台构建_姜毅
  • 研究与开发 研究与开发 基于开源软件的私有云计算平台构建* 姜 毅 1,2 ,王伟军1,曹丽3,刘凯1,陈桂强 1 (1. 华中师范大学信息管理学院武汉430079:2. 浙江理工大学经济管理学院杭州310018: 3. 浙江理工大学信息学院杭州310018) 摘 要:介绍了私有云的应用范围,讨论了 ...

  • SciTE研究 - 中文小组
  • http://groups.google.com/group/scite-cn SciTE研究 - 中文小组 2008-08-28 10:24 初学者入门教程 360pskdocImg_0_xyz 简单介绍 360pskdocImg_1_xyzSciTE(Scintilla Text Editor) ...

  • linux嵌入式学习路线(新版)
  • 嵌入式学习路线图 嵌入式开发学习路线图 为什么选择学习嵌入式? 嵌入式系统无疑是当前最热门最有发展前途的IT应用领域之一,同时也是当今IT领域仅存的几个金领职位之一.当前的中国IT人才面临严重的"后继乏人", 而且这种缺口由于培训缺乏.教育模式等原因造成的,而缺口最大的,就是高级 ...

  • FPGA的嵌入式系统 来自 对待同一事物不一样的心情,将有不同的感受
  • FPGA的嵌入式系统 2011-08-12 00:10 1.什么是嵌入式系统? 在<基于PowerPC的嵌入式Linux>一书中,表述为:在有限的资源及有限的体积中运行的.高效地实现某种特殊功能的功能集合. IEEE(电气和电子工程师协会) 的定义,嵌入式系统是"控制.监视或者 ...

  • 旧电脑的11个用途
  • 你终于买来了一台新电脑,它配备了大容量内存.多核处理器和快速的最新显卡.而那台旧电脑正待在角落里,你知道它好歹是台陪伴你很久的机器,一想到扔掉它就觉得过意不去. 毕竟,它完全可以使用.当初你买来时,它的配置差不多是最先进的.当然,要是新电脑换掉的确实是该寿终正寝的电脑,大可交给一家信誉卓著的电子产品 ...

  • 如何建立宽带连接
  • 如何建立宽带连接 下面有四种主流系统建立宽带连接的方法: Windows 7(windows 8).Windows XP .Linux.MAC OS 1.Windows 7(Windows 8) 右击桌面右下角的网络连接图标,点击"打开网络和共享中心",如下图所示. 会弹出如图, ...

  • 中小企业服务云平台建设项目设计方案
  • XX 软件园中小微企业公共服务平台 暨XX 软件园中小企业服务云平台 设计方案 目 录 第1章 项目概述 . ............................................................................................... ...